摘要

The environmental effects of electricity production from different biofuels by means of electricity production from hard coal alone based on Life Cycle Analysis (LCA). The use of straw and residual wood at a 10 blend with coal in an existing power plant in southern part of Germany shows that all investigated environmental effects are significantly lower if biomass is used instead of coal. Thus based on the available and proven technology of co-combustion of hard coal and biomass in existing power plants a significant contribution could be made to a more environmentally sound energy system compared to using coal alone.
